The bead stitch is a lace knitting pattern with a unique texture. It creates an interesting fabric of interwoven segments with an organic feel. These segments are reminiscent of strands of beads or links in a watch chain. Although this stitch pattern is only 4 rows long, it's relatively complicated. Cross stitch - stitch guide. Running Stitch is the most basic hand embroidery stitch. It is simply an "up and down" stitch in the fabric. Even though it's such a basic embroidery stitch, there are many, many things you can do with it!
